Global Market Landscape & Strategic Demand Drivers for Protein Formulations

The global demand for high-density, protein-rich formulations has crossed a paradigm threshold. Driven by demographic shifts, global sustainability mandates, and the rising prevalence of plant-centric consumer diets, the global plant-based protein market is projected to surpass $35 Billion USD by 2030, exhibiting a compound annual growth rate (CAGR) exceeding 8.6%. Enterprise procurement decisions are no longer governed solely by crude protein percentage; modern food scientists and pharmaceutical formulators demand targeted biological functionality, optimized amino acid profiles (PDCAAS = 1.0), low allergenicity, and clean-label neutrality in flavor and color.

Regional Intent & Sourcing Micro-Trends

A granular evaluation of enterprise procurement intent across major global regions reveals distinct technological and commercial priorities:

  • European Union (EU): Procurement strategies are heavily dictated by stringent EU food safety regulations (Novel Food Regulation EC 2015/2283), non-GMO verifications, and mandatory CE/HACCP compliance. European buyers prioritize zero-pesticide residue, low heavy-metal thresholds, and sustainable carbon-neutral manufacturing practices.
  • North America: Demand is dominated by active sports nutrition, keto-friendly dietary supplements, and high-moisture meat analogues (HMMA). Key formulation requirements focus on rapid solubility, low viscosity under heat processing, and allergen-free profiles (pea, pumpkin seed, chickpea, and potato proteins).
  • Asia-Pacific & Middle East: Rapidly expanding industrial fermentation, cosmetics peptide active ingredients, and HALAL-certified functional beverages drive massive demand for soy protein isolates, wheat peptides, and specialized bacteriological media peptones (TSB media).

Localized Application Matrix: Target Industry Blueprint

Formulating with protein isolates and bio-peptides requires a thorough understanding of matrix interactions, heat thermal stability, pH sensitivity, and ionic strength. Hangzhou Entry Bio Co., Ltd. collaborates directly with client R&D teams to provide customized formulation parameters across five strategic market segments:

1. Sports Nutrition & Active Lifestyle Formulations

In modern sports nutrition, rapid gastric emptying and immediate blood amino acid concentration are essential. Our Organic Pea & Brown Rice Protein Isolate combination delivers a complete essential amino acid (EAA) and branched-chain amino acid (BCAA) profile equivalent to premium whey protein. Its natural buffering capacity prevents stomach distress, while zero lactose ensures 100% digestibility for lactose-intolerant athletes.

2. Meat Alternatives & Extruded Plant Formulations

For high-moisture extrusion (HMMA) and dry textured vegetable protein (TVP) manufacturing, molecular cross-linking capability under thermal shear is critical. Our specialized high-gelation Soy Protein Isolates form fibrous, muscle-like textures with exceptional oil and water retention ratios (1:5:5), guaranteeing juicy mouthfeel and structural integrity in vegan burgers, sausages, and nuggets.

3. Cosmeceuticals & Personal Care Actives

Bio-active skin and hair conditioning relies on deep epidermal penetration. Our flagship Hydrolyzed Wheat Protein Peptide Powder (Low MW <1000Da, CAS 222400-29-5) is molecularly optimized to penetrate the hair cuticle and stratum corneum. It repairs damaged keratin matrices, increases moisture retention by up to 35%, and reduces surfactant-induced skin irritation in high-end personal care products.

4. Biopharmaceuticals & Culture Media (TSB Medium)

Precision biopharmaceutical fermentation requires consistent nitrogen sources free of animal-derived pathogens. Our Protein Peptone Soybean Liquid Medium (Ready-to-use TSB Medium) is manufactured under sterile cleanroom standards, providing optimal amino nitrogen, vitamins, and carbohydrate trace nutrients for industrial microbiological culture, vaccine manufacturing, and quality control sterility testing.

5. Functional Beverages & Dairy Alternatives

Achieving stable suspension without sedimentation or chalkiness in plant-based milks requires low-viscosity, heat-stable proteins. Our High-Purity Soy Protein Isolate for Plant-Based Milk demonstrates superior thermal stability during UHT processing, eliminating phase separation and imparting a rich, cream-like mouthfeel to almond, oat, and soy milk beverages.

Future Trends in Protein Bio-Engineering (2025–2030)

The protein industry is undergoing a radical technological transformation toward targeted molecular functionality. Key vectors shaping future product innovation include:

  • Precision Enzymatic Cleaving: Moving beyond crude protein concentrates toward targeted micro-peptides with specific physiological activities (anti-hypertensive, antioxidant, and immune-modulating peptides).
  • Microalgae Mass Cultivation: Expanding sustainable spirulina and chlorella bioreactor cultivation, delivering 70%+ protein yields with zero arable land depletion.
  • Clean Label & Flavor Neutrality: Utilizing advanced deodorization and debittering bio-enzymes to remove beany off-flavors natively present in plant proteins without synthetic masking chemicals.

Q2: Why is the molecular weight distribution (<1000Da) critical for Hydrolyzed Wheat Peptides in personal care?
Peptides with a molecular weight under 1000 Daltons possess ultra-low molecular dimensions capable of traversing the cuticular scales of human hair shaft and penetrating the upper epidermal layers. This ensures deep structural repair, enhanced amino acid binding, and superior film-forming properties compared to unhydrolyzed native proteins.

Q6: What is the typical shelf life and storage recommendation for bulk plant protein powders?
When stored in original unopened multi-layer kraft paper packaging with inner polyethylene liners in a cool, dry place (< 25°C, relative humidity < 60%), our protein powders retain full sensory, micro-biological, and functional stability for 24 months from the date of manufacture.
